Crystal structure of SET and MYND domain containing 3; Zinc finger MYND domain-containing protein 1

Function

[SMYD3_HUMAN] Histone methyltransferase. Specifically methylates 'Lys-4' and 'Lys-5' of histone H3, inducing di- and tri-methylation, but not monomethylation. Plays an important role in transcriptional activation as a member of an RNA polymerase complex. Binds DNA containing 5'-CCCTCC-3' or 5'-GAGGGG-3' sequences.[1] [2]

About this Structure

3qwp is a 1 chain structure with sequence from Homo sapiens. Full crystallographic information is available from OCA.
